Linear Motor Service

Linear motors are popular in West Covina for their compact design and quiet operation, especially on tight driveway clearances where a swing arm would interfere with parking. Installation typically runs $720-$1,100. We see two recurring issues with linears in this city: Santa Ana wind gusts fatiguing the gate frame until the motor’s torque sensor starts tripping prematurely, and clay-soil heave changing the gate’s geometry enough that the linear actuator binds at full extension. Both problems require fixing the gate structure, not just swapping the motor.

Slide Motor Service

Slide motors suit West Covina’s narrower lots and alley-loaded driveways where a swing gate would arc into the sidewalk or street. New installs run $780-$1,350 depending on track length and motor capacity. The critical factor here is track alignment. On sloped lots near the San Jose Hills, differential soil moisture - uphill post stays drier, downhill post saturates - drives the track out of level within a few seasons. We address this by resetting post footings with deeper concrete piers that extend below the active clay zone, then realigning the motor and track as an integrated system.

Battery Backup

Battery backup for gate openers is essential in West Covina, where SCE Public Safety Power Shutoffs during Santa Ana wind events have become routine. A battery backup system runs $280-$480 installed and provides 8-12 full cycles during an outage. We install backup-compatible systems on new motors and can retrofit most existing openers manufactured after 2018. For older motors, we’ll give you an honest assessment of whether the retrofit makes sense or if a replacement with integrated backup is the smarter spend.

Common Gate Motor & Opener Problems We See in West Covina Homes

  • Santa Ana wind fatigue on wrought-iron gates. The dry, high-velocity wind events that sweep through the eastern San Gabriel Valley place repeated lateral stress on older gate frames. Fatigued welds flex more than they should, causing the motor’s torque sensor to read abnormal resistance and reverse the gate mid-cycle.
  • Differential heave on sloped lots. In the 91791 and 91792 ZIPs, hillside drainage patterns keep uphill posts drier while downhill posts repeatedly saturate. The clay expands and contracts unevenly, racking the gate out of square and binding slide motors or overloading swing motor actuators.
  • Shallow original post footings. Most 1950s-1970s West Covina gates were set on posts with footings two feet deep or less. Seasonal clay expansion at that shallow depth shifts the post enough to throw off limit switches and safety sensors, even when the motor itself is mechanically sound.
  • Power surge damage during wind events. Santa Ana winds down lines and cause brief outages that send voltage spikes when power returns. We’ve replaced more circuit boards in West Covina after November wind storms than in any other month of the year.

In the hillside lots near the San Jose Hills (91791), we serviced a LiftMaster slide motor that had started reversing mid-cycle. The downhill gate post had settled 1.5 inches out of plumb after a heavy winter rain, causing the gate to bind on the track. We re-set the post footing with a deeper concrete pier below the clay zone and realigned the motor. The gate now opens without issue even during Santa Ana wind events.
